How We Work
1
Initial Assessment
Our team arrives quickly to survey the damage, using moisture meters to identify water damage and assess the scope of the job. We document everything for insurance purposes.
2
Extraction and Cleanup
We use industrial-strength pumps to extract water and wet equipment to prevent further damage. Our technicians then clean and disinfect the affected areas with antimicrobial solutions.
3
Drying and Dehumidification
We deploy industrial drying equipment to quickly remove moisture from the air and surfaces. This reduces the risk of mold growth and further damage.
4
Final Inspection and Completion
We inspect the property to ensure everything is dry and safe. Our team provides a detailed report and obtains a final inspection from the customer before completing the job.

What Causes This Problem

  • Clogs from excessive toilet paper or foreign objects can cause overflow.
  • Wear and tear on plumbing fixtures may lead to failures.
  • Improper installation of toilets can create drainage issues.
  • Tree roots invading pipes may cause blockages and overflows.

South Gate residents often deal with older plumbing systems, which can be particularly susceptible to issues. Is Toilet Overflow Cleanup a DIY Task?

While minor issues can be managed, professional cleanup is crucial for significant overflows to ensure safety and proper sanitation.

What Should I Do Immediately After an Overflow?

Contact a professional immediately, and turn off the water supply to prevent further damage.

How Long Does the Cleanup Process Take?

The duration of the cleanup process depends on the severity of the incident but generally ranges from a few hours to a full day.

Will My Home Be Affected by Mold After an Overflow?

If not addressed promptly, mold growth is a risk; our professionals closely monitor and mitigate these issues during the cleanup.
